Chopra's Designs partners with Marq to create an all-engulfing multimedia experience that utilises all the services of acoustics, lighting design, projection mapping, digital art, and interactive art installations within its volume, located in the heart ofDubai. Each design decision has been carefully curated to bring a rich expanse of visual experiences for the visitors to the nightclub.

The Marq Nightclub experience begins the very moment guests pass through its dynamic walkway. The lobby boasts a cascading waterfall with a motion-sensor screen to mimic the visitors' movements, thus exploring human interaction with a digital medium of art. With this dynamic visual representation of the guests, they step inside an enigmatic space that envelops them in wonder. A symphony of lights unfolds as five different types of LED installations illuminate the entire space. Among these LEDs, one is broken into several hexagons like an art installation, gracefully moving on hydraulics in sync with the music's pulsating beat, while another forms a curtain of lights at the back of the VIP enclave. The columns are enveloped by captivating visuals brought to life through light projections, ensuring the incorporation of multimedia media in spatial elements of the structure as well. A continuous stretch of immersive visuals is materialised as the stage backdrop design via an LED media wall extending from the rear of the DJ booth to the ceiling. The spatial volume also showcases and advances the Digital Multiplex (DMX) lighting services, where the VIP section is adorned by a laser grid. Synchronised video content, lighting choreography, and soundscapes converge to form a harmonious palette of changing hues.

This enthralling tale of motion and emotion provides a glimpse into the show-stopping moments of the nightclub. A myriad of innovative multimedia strategies serves as a time capsule where the journey of an immersive experience starts and ends within the essence of Marq.

Well indicative of the term, "Celestial" comes forth as a creative collaboration between Chopra’s Designs and design curators The Envelop, pictured within the confines of Mehrangarh Fort in Jodhpur to enhance key moments at a wedding event. Fed with a brief to amplify all things Celestial, Chopra’s Designs’ expertise as lighting designers captivates those in attendance in a journey through the world of universes on a massive illusionistic scale, both physically and virtually.

This spectacle forms an intricate ecosystem of lighting and projection installations, accompanied by an ambient lighting design that vividly portrays a multitude of themes present in the Universe. Segregated into various zones of Shuttle, Sun, Moon, Stars, and the Galaxy, visitors are led through distinct immersive spaces, each offering unique moods and performances. Each zone compresses people through an array of interconnecting areas to release them into a different dimension with a harmonious blend of innovation, aesthetics, and effective event planning. Seamless transitions between these spaces are designed for an elevated experience using LED design data walls, and the synchronised dance of Digital Multiplex (DMX) lighting adds to the splendour, creating a multi-dimensional experience.

The centrepiece, "The Star Universe," emerges as a standalone experience. The starry Universe features dotted stars, disco ball pyramids that mimic star surfaces, and a laser sky that forms a celestial canopy, all availing a spectrum of Chopra’s Designs’ services. A giant suspended star installation curated on the kinetic motors took the theme to new heights. Additionally, the Sun is curated using a massive sandpit with light projections all around and fire artists’ loud, bold performances slathered in red. The sun installation replicates the one we see in the skies; the centre here shines constantly, emitting intense light, making it impossible to gaze at the creative execution. When Lux Nightclub in Jaipur, India, aimed to establish an iconic visual statement in their primary atrium dance area, they turned to Chopra's Designs for a phy-gital installation synchronised with the club's music. Reimagining the traditional chandelier, Chopra's Designs boldly reinvents the nightclub's lighting experience by crafting a captivating art piece infused with multimedia elements powered by Madrix technology.

Driven by a vision to establish a captivating focal point, the grand chandelier, with its intricate serpentine geometry, stretches across the expansive space, redefining its ambience. The production elements of the immense apparatus include theatrical lighting effects, video projections and multimedia technology. The chandelier's lights come alive through motion-programmed LED technology, allowing each segment to dance and transform, creating an ever-shifting display that adds drama and vibrancy to the space. Contrasting the chandelier's sinuous form is a linear arrangement of DMX lights, injecting bursts of vivid colours against the backdrop of the dimly yet alluringly lit wave-like structure.

Teaming up with live artist performances, the chandelier transforms the nightclub into an immersive haven for every guest. Beyond its visual splendour, Chopra's Designs ensures the chandelier's functionality is fully programmable, collaborating closely with the nightclub staff to self-customise its control system. This adaptability empowers a diverse array of immersive lighting designs to seamlessly integrate with the chandelier whenever the occasion calls for it.

Raising the stakes by introducing a large-scale immersive experience to a nightclub, the Playboy Club pushes their long-standing collaboration with Chopra’s Designs to new heights with its grand launch in New Delhi, India. Using breathtaking productions that include aesthetics, engineering, and logistics, attention is brought to the complete integration of multimedia design into the experience of social gatherings.

In order to establish this blend of creative ingenuity and technical finesse within the entertainment trade, which brings people together for a collective experience, the team utilises an array of technological installations. This includes a mesmerising network of six hundred laser beams that fill the volume of the club with an invigorating pulse, along with a vivid canvas of 3 million pixels of video that brings scenes to life in a dynamic manner. The dance arena holds a kinetic chandelier of broken rings, accented with scenic integrated LED ribbons as the central lighting installation. To harness the potential of LED wall designs showing digital art, the stunning bar art installation provides an ever-changing bunny sculpture visual display, animating 10-metre-wide bunny hologram projections that skillfully showcase the brand’s identity in an innovative and imaginative fashion.
